Green Patriot and OCA Expose 1,4 Dioxane in Household Products
March 12, at a press conference held adjacent to the Natural Products Expo West, the Green Patriot Working Group (GPWG), led by environmental health consumer advocate David Steinman, and the Organic Consumers Association announced that Procter and Gamble (P&G) and the Green Patriot have reached an agreement in principle that P&G will reformulate its top-selling Herbal Essences brand to reduce levels of the carcinogenic contaminant 1,4-dioxane. The press conference also announced new 1,4-dioxane test results for twenty laundry detergents, of which notably some of the most popular mainstream brands - including Dial, Church & Dwight Co. and Procter & Gamble - had the highest levels overall.
